jquery - CSS 不切换

标签 jquery

以下内容成功切换了 divlord_pop_up。但是,它不会在切换时设置 divlord_pop_up 的 css 属性。任何想法将不胜感激。我尝试在切换时将 popupBox 高度从 20em 更改为 42em。

$(function () {
    $('#toggle1').click(function () {
        $('#landlord_pop_up').slideToggle(function () {
            $(".popupBox").css({
                "height": "42em"
            });
        }, function () {
            $(".popupBox").css({
                "height": "20em"
            });
        });
    });
});

最佳答案

滑动后切换弹出框的高度:

$(function() {
    $('#toggle1').click(function() {
        $('#landlord_pop_up').slideToggle(function(){
            $(".popupBox").toggle(function () {
                $(this).height("42em");
            }, function () {
                $(this).height("20em");
            });
        });
    });
});

关于jquery - CSS 不切换,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/12316993/

相关文章:

javascript - 包含图像路径 (uri) 和标题的数组

javascript - 单击另一个按钮触发共享按钮

jquery - 如果 LI 元素是父元素且具有 UL(子元素或子菜单),如何附加此范围

php - 物理仪表板/状态板的库和伪代码

javascript - 动态创建的按钮 onClick 不起作用

jquery - 如何在父 div 悬停时更改 img src?

jquery - 如何开发 iPad 网络应用程序以应对 wifi 中断

javascript - 在 Javascript 中检查图像和视频加载失败的正确方法?

javascript - Bootstrap-select.js - 选择一个选项后,整个选择消失

javascript - 在我的 URL 中添加参数?